Eyeliner has long been a staple in beauty rituals, tracing its roots back to Ancient Egypt, where both men and women donned the cosmetic to enhance their eyes. The iconic kohl, a mixture of soot, galena, and other minerals, was not only used for aesthetic purposes but also believed to offer protection from the sun's glare and ward off evil spirits. Ancient Egyptians would apply eyeliner with thick strokes, often extending it outward in dramatic wings, setting the foundation for many styles that are popular today. The spiritual significance attributed to eyeliner in Egyptian culture cannot be overstated, as it was seen as a means to invoke the favor of the gods.
As centuries passed, the use of eyeliner evolved through various cultures, gaining newfound popularity during the Renaissance and later in the Victorian era. By the 20th century, iconic figures like Audrey Hepburn and Marilyn Monroe propelled eyeliner into mainstream fashion, leading to the creation of modern products such as liquid and gel eyeliners. Today, eyeliner is a favorite among makeup enthusiasts worldwide, offering a variety of styles ranging from subtle definitions to bold, graphic designs. This enduring cosmetic continues to adapt, showcasing its rich history while remaining a crucial aspect of contemporary beauty trends.
Choosing the perfect eyeliner for your eye shape can enhance your natural beauty and make your eyes stand out. Start by identifying your eye shape: almond, round, hooded, or monolid. Each shape has a different set of characteristics that can influence how eyeliner looks. For example, those with almond-shaped eyes can experiment with various styles, while round eyes may benefit from a winged style to create an elongated appearance.
